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
114542 481204 35129169 8189443
237912 423
237912 423
36607159 63 5470589
All about undefined
Interested in learning more?
237912 423
36607159 63 5470589
See more
976139 15945751
06675716006 79222 73826684
See more
22 78595960 4188567
646 6590944 12 74594134869
See more